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?
Annotations already declare readOnlyHint, idempotentHint, and destructiveHint, so the safety profile is clear. The description adds bulk support behavior, which is valuable. However, it does not disclose any additional behavioral traits like authentication needs or rate limits.
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.
Is the description appropriately sized, front-loaded, and free of redundancy?
The description is extremely concise: two sentences covering purpose and bulk support. It is front-loaded with the primary function and contains no wasted words.
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.
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?
The description covers the core function and bulk feature, but lacks detail on the return value (no output schema) and does not address error handling or prerequisites. For a simple status-check tool, it is adequate but not fully complete.
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.
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?
The input schema has 0% description coverage, so the description must compensate. It adds meaning for order_id (specified as the ID) and order_ids (bulk support), but the account parameter is not mentioned at all, leaving ambiguity.
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.
Does the description clearly state what the tool does and how it differs from similar tools?
The description clearly states the tool's purpose: getting the status of a specific order by its ID, and mentions bulk support. However, it does not differentiate this tool from sibling tools like bity_executed_orders or bity_open_orders, which reduces clarity on when to use this specific tool.
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.
Does the description explain when to use this tool, when not to, or what alternatives exist?
The description provides no guidance on when to use this tool versus alternatives. It only explains how to use parameters (by ID and bulk) but does not specify contexts or exclusions, leaving the agent without decision support.
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.

Each Bity tool targets a distinct resource (balance, orders, ticker, trades, orderbook) and the platform tools (authenticate, connect, marketplace, etc.) serve clearly separate functions. There is no real overlap or ambiguity between any of the tools.
The Bity tools use a 'bity_' prefix, but the naming pattern is inconsistent: bity_get_balance uses a verb, while bity_orderbook and bity_ticker are just nouns. The non-Bity tools (authenticate, connect, marketplace, report_bug, show_version, toolkit_info) follow no common pattern and break the verb_noun convention.
At 14 tools, the count is within a reasonable range, but the server mixes a focused Bity integration with generic platform tools (marketplace, report_bug, etc.), making the scope feel inflated. A dedicated Bity server would not need the platform-layer tools, so the count is slightly high for the apparent purpose.
The Bity toolset covers read-only operations: balance, orders, ticker, trades, orderbook. There is no tool to create, cancel, or modify orders, which is a fundamental omission for a trading exchange. The server cannot execute any trades, so it fails to provide a complete lifecycle for its core domain.
